Introduction

Product Overview

This specification covers the 1.0mm Pitch FPC Connectors, designed for flexible flat cable connections. These connectors are suitable for applications requiring a 1.0mm pitch with a rated voltage of 50V AC/DC and a rated current of 0.5A. They are built to withstand a wide operating temperature range of -25 to +85 and have undergone rigorous electrical, mechanical, and environmental testing to ensure reliable performance.

Product Attributes

  • Brand: SHENZHEN SHOUHAN TECHNOLOGY CO.,LTD ()
  • Product Name: FFC/FPC Flat Cable Connector
  • Material (Main body): LCP UL 94V-0
  • Material (Locking Housing): LCP UL 94V-0
  • Material (Terminal/Contact): Phosphor Bronze
  • Surface Treatment: Metal surface plated with tin
  • Origin: Shenzhen, China

Technical Specifications

Item Specification/Requirement Test Condition
Ratings
Rated Voltage (MAX) 50V AC/DC (Virtual value, 50Hz)
Rated Current (MAX) 0.5A
Ambient Temperature Range -25 ~ +85
Electrical Performance
Contact Resistance 30 m MAX Mate applicable FPC/FFC and measure by dry circuit, 20mV MAX, 10mA.
Insulation Resistance 500M MIN Mate applicable FPC/FFC and apply 500V DC between adjacent terminals or ground.
Dielectric Strength No Breakdown Mate applicable FPC/FFC and apply 250V AC (Virtual value) for 1 minute between adjacent terminals or ground.
Mechanical Performance
Locking Force 1.96*n (N) MAX Insert and extract applicable FFC (0.3mm thickness) at a speed of 253mm/minute.
Withdrawal Force 0.49*n (N) MIN Insert and extract applicable FFC (0.3mm thickness) at a speed of 253mm/minute.
Terminal/Housing Retention Force 0.25N MIN Pull the terminal outwards parallel at a speed of 25 3mm per minute.
